A Great Read!

James Peters and his public relations firm partner, Woodrow Wilson (Woody) Cox are off on a "work" weekend of cocktail parties, college football and golf at Ben State University. After the first night of heavy drinking and arguing with his partner, James decides to skip the game (he hates football, anyway) and the golf (he doesn't play the game). He leaves Woody a message with the hotel switchboard and heads home. Come Monday morning, Woody doesn't show up for work. He's not at home and he's not at the hotel. He never checked out and his car and clothes are still there. Woody's disappearance becomes a police matter and it doesn't take them long to find his dead body. Who saw him alive, last...his partner, James Peters and now he's the number one suspect in Woody's murder. To make matters even worse, business is bad, James and his wife are separated, he wants her back and she now wants a divorce, a couple of tough guys are after him and he's not sure why and his new TV reporter girlfriend is demanding an exclusive on Woody's murder..... Douglas Lee Gibboney has written a funny, compelling, spectacular murder mystery that has it all. The writing is eloquent and crisp and Mr Gibboney has a great ear for witty and irreverent dialogue. The well paced plot and vivid scenes are full of twists, turns and surprises that keep you off balance and guessing to the very last page of the book. An exciting, yet funny find that shouldn't be passed over!

It's amazing to find that so few people have heard of Douglas Lee Gibboney and this book, MURDER AT CLEAVER STADIUM. He and this book rank up there with the best of the contemporary suspense authors, yet he's a dark humorist as well.To describe it as just a murder mystery does not do it justice, as this novel is also very funny in places where one would least expect it. It's one of those books that was obviously fun to write from the author's perspective - a book that's not only entertaining and witty, but one with many subtle twists and surprises. This book is written in the first person, and on the first page the protagonist, James Peters, makes a confession. No, it's not what you would think - it's that he has never been a football fan. After some descriptions on the same page about football and a Ben State coach that will leave you laughing, this book takes off. The character descriptions are lively, real and often humorous. It will not only keep you guessing, but also just when you think you may have figured everything out, a new twist will throw you off track, and often laughing at the same time. This is not a book that you want to pick up and open as a casual read, as after the first chapter it's difficult to put it down. Each chapter beings either a new twist of a hilarious description of a person or event that will leave you in stitches. To say that there are some surprises here is an understatement. To add to all of this, James Peters has occasion to play the piano in the course of the plot, and of course the lyrics to the songs he plays are printed. What makes all of this even more interesting is that the author has just released a music CD entitled "Guitars, Girls & Motels." Rumor has it that some of the songs from the book are on this CD.
